Abstract
The invention provides a special automatic pressure release valve of a rescue capsule, which is capable of exhausting residual gas in the capsule and simultaneously preventing external harmful gases from entering the capsule. The special automatic pressure release is characterized in that a valve body is in the shape of a circular tube, an inner end cover is arranged on a port of the inner end of the valve body, a gas outlet hole is disposed on the inner end cover, the outer surface of the inner end of the valve body is in the shape of a concave spigot, threads on the outer surface of the concave spigot match with a locking nut, the surface of an inner cavity of the outer end of the valve body is in the shape of a convex spigot, a valve clack seat, a stopper and an outer end cover are sequentially disposed on the convex spigot, vent holes are disposed on both the stopper and the outer end cover, the valve clack seat is in the shape of a circular box, vent holes are arranged on an inner box cover and an outer box cover of the valve clack seat, namely the circular box, a circular valve clack is disposed in a cavity of the circular box, the circle center of the circular valve clack is fixed onto the circle center of the inner box cover of the circular box by a positioning pin, and all the vent holes on the inner box cover are covered by the circular valve clack.

Background technique
Arranging in mine and the use mine escape capsule, is an important measure in the mine emergency management and rescue.When the security incident such as blasting under the mine, what the miners of down-hole at first were subject to is the threat of harmful gas, unnecessary gas in the cabin can be released, stops simultaneously harmful gas out of my cabin to enter automatic decompression valve in the cabin in the urgent need to one on the rescue capsule.
Summary of the invention
For solving the problems of the technologies described above, the invention provides a kind of Special automatic pressure release valve of rescue capsule.
The object of the present invention is achieved like this: valve body is tubular shape, and it has two ends, and an end is positioned at rescue capsule outer (hereinafter referred to as out of my cabin), cry the outer end, the other end is named the inner end in (in the cabin) in the rescue capsule, the port of valve body inner end has the inner end lid, has covered air outlet hole in the inner end; Valve body inner end outer surface is recessed seam shape, screw thread on the outer surface of this recessed seam cooperates with locking nut, and recessed seam is used for from inserting the cinclides of wearing of rescue capsule bulkhead out of my cabin, screw on the seam in the cabin with locking nut again, the present invention is installed and is locked on the bulkhead; Valve body outer end surface of internal cavity is male half coupling shape, sets gradually flap seat, jam and outer end cap at male half coupling, wherein on jam and the outer end cap vent is arranged all, and it is box-like that the flap seat is circle, the flap seat namely round box inside and outside on two lids vent is set all; The circle box has circular flap in the chamber, and locating stud is fixed on the center of circle of circular flap on the center of circle of lid in the round box, and circular flap covers all vents on the inner lid.
When the atmospheric pressure in the cabin during greater than out of my cabin air pressure and exceedance, the vent of lid in the air outlet hole that gas in the cabin covers through the inner end successively, body cavity and the flap seat, under the effect of this air pressure, the flap distortion, the vent of inner lid is opened, gas enters the i.e. round box chamber of flap seat inner chamber, is discharged to out of my cabin from the vent of outer lid and outer end cap successively again.This process is called positive draft.Otherwise when the pressure in the cabin during less than out of my cabin pressure, gas enters round box chamber from the vent of outer end cap and outer lid successively out of my cabin, is lived by the flap shelves, and namely flap is closed, and gas barrier is in out of my cabin out of my cabin.
Compared with prior art, good effect of the present invention is: it releases unnecessary gas in the cabin automatically, stops simultaneously out of my cabin that harmful gas enters in the cabin, ensures hedging personnel's safety.

Embodiment
Referring to Fig. 1,2, valve body 3 is tubular shape, and the port of valve body inner end has inner end lid 4, has covered air outlet hole 41 in the inner end; Valve body inner end outer surface is recessed seam shape, screw thread on the outer surface of this recessed seam cooperates with locking nut 5, and recessed seam is used for from inserting the cinclides of wearing of rescue capsule bulkhead out of my cabin, screw on the seam in the cabin with locking nut again, the present invention is installed and is locked on the bulkhead; Valve body outer end surface of internal cavity is male half coupling shape, set gradually flap seat 7, jam 2 and outer end cap 1 at male half coupling, jam vent 21 is wherein arranged on the jam, outer end cap vent 11 is arranged on the outer end cap, it is box-like that the flap seat is circle, the flap seat namely round box in lid 71 inner lid vent 711 is set, on the outer lid 72 vent 721 is set; The circle box has circular flap 6 in the chamber, locating stud 8 is fixed on the center of circle of circular flap on the center of circle of lid in the round box, circular flap covers all 711 holes of ventilating on the inner lid, the method that covers is: all vents of (referring to Fig. 3) inner lid are arranged on the circumference, and the diameter of this circumference is less than the diameter of flap.
